The comparison between ProtonVPN Free Plan and VPN.ac is particularly interesting due to their distinct approaches to privacy and security, catering to different user needs. ProtonVPN Free Plan excels in providing a user-friendly experience with its intuitive interface, making it accessible for casual users who prioritize privacy without the need for technical expertise. Its standout feature is the Secure Core architecture, which routes traffic through multiple servers in privacy-friendly countries, enhancing anonymity.
Additionally, ProtonVPN's commitment to a no-logs policy and strong encryption standards ensures that user data remains protected. On the other hand, VPN.ac is tailored for users with a more technical background, offering advanced features such as double-hop connections and fine-grained control over protocols and encryption settings. This makes VPN.ac a superior choice for users who require a higher level of customization and security.
While ProtonVPN Free Plan is ideal for casual users, VPN.ac's robust security features and obfuscation options make it more suitable for privacy-conscious individuals who are willing to engage with a more complex interface. Ultimately, the choice between the two services hinges on the user's technical proficiency and specific privacy needs, with ProtonVPN Free Plan being the better option for general users and VPN.ac appealing to those seeking advanced security features.

compare Feature Comparison
| Feature | VPN.ac | ProtonVPN Free Plan |
|---|---|---|
| No-Logs Policy | Yes, strict no-logs policy | Yes, strict no-logs policy |
| Secure Core Servers | No, does not offer this feature | Yes, enhances anonymity |
| Double-Hop Connections | Yes, provides enhanced security | No, not available |
| User Interface | Technical and complex | Intuitive and user-friendly |
| Performance Optimization | Optimized for speed and performance | Good for casual use |
| Device Compatibility | Supports multiple devices | Supports multiple devices |
